Review of massive dilepton production in proton nucleus collisions

Description

Recent experiments on production of lepton pairs in proton-nucleus collisions at large effective dilepton mass are reviewed. Production of lepton pairs with masses above the J/psi and psi' region (m > = 4 GeV/c2) is discussed in terms of continuum dilepton production. Experimental setups are briefly described, and production cross sections are shown. 13 figures
